    I apologize if this has been discussed in another thread but I didn’t see a thread dedicated to the Rays in general so here goes:

    They Rays are exploring options/plans in playing half of their games in Tampa area and the other half in Montreal within a few years. They are also expecting new stadiums to be built in both cities?

    Not only is that crazy, but any city official who agrees to this should immediately be removed. Not only is that just absurd but how are you gonna build an open air stadium in the Tampa area during the summer with the humidity and frequent rain storms?

    Not defending the TB owners, but I believe their stated plan is to play the summer games in Montreal and the early/late season games in Tampa.

    In my view, it has been proven that MLB in Florida does not work, so the best answer may be relocation of both teams. Building a white elephant stadium for what may only be 41 home games per season won’t work for many reasons, but the veiled threat of losing the team is a known strategy by wealthy owners to squeeze money from municipalities.

    If the interim TB-Montreal plan could get off the ground with the current stadiums and no new taxpayer money spent, maybe the Canadians could show enough to get the team full-time.
